Winning the 5000m Men's Race: A Complete Breakdown of Strategies and Techniques
In athletics, the 5000m race is a challenge that tests endurance and willpower. This sport requires runners not only to have excellent respiratory ability, but also to precise strategy and technique. In the 5000m journey, each competitor fought hard for the final victory line. Here is a comprehensive guide to help you become a cost-effective winner in the 5000m field:
Strategy sharing
Starting and early sprint: Starting is different from the 100 or 400m sprint, so don't exhaust yourself at the beginning, and it is wise to start at a constant speed to maintain long-lasting running momentum. The first 1500 meters should be completed at 75%-80% of the time.
Midway rhythm: Pay attention to the sense of rhythm, perform an "explosive" sprint about every 500 meters, and quickly recover physical strength after a short acceleration, which will help boost morale and surpass opponents.
Consolidate the lead: 2,000 meters from the finish line is a crucial time to widen the gap. At this time, you should gradually strengthen your leading position or look for opportunities to surpass.
Physical fitness and technical improvement
Breath control: Learning good breathing techniques is crucial. Use the method of inhaling and exhaling through the nose, maintain deep breathing, and ensure adequate oxygen. When running, the rhythm is synchronized with breathing, and each step can be combined with inhalation and exhalation.
Leg strength: Strengthen the leg muscles, especially the calves and back thighs, which can help improve cadence and pedaling strength. Proper strength training (e.g., squats, leg presses) can help you stay productive on the track.
Psychological adjustment
In the face of the long and difficult 5000m challenge, mental toughness and perseverance are strong supports. Face every difficulty in the event with positive self-suggestion and mentality. Before the game, you can reduce stress through meditation, enhance your stress resistance, and maintain a good pre-game rhythm.
